Disability Sports

 
Sport Kingston is committed to ensure that people of all abilities have the opportunity to enjoy and play sport.
Since October 1999 sports clubs have had to make ‘reasonable adjustments’ for disabled people, such as providing extra help or making changes to the way they provide their service.
These changes could be as small as ensuring that lockers and coat hooks are the correct height for wheelchair users or provide training for Coaches. Most of the changes are not difficult and just need common sense and looking at things from a different perspective.
There are many organisations that can support your club by offering ideas, information, workshops and other initiatives to help make your club inclusive.

Interactive
Three out of four disabled Londoners are inactive; more than double the figure for non-disabled people. The majority of disabled Londoners do not view activity as a viable lifestyle choice for them. Interactive exists to change this.
